The Anatomy of a Stellar News Script
First things first, what are the key components of a news script? You'll typically find an intro, a body, and a conclusion. Sounds simple, right? But the magic is in the details. The intro is your hook. It's the first thing your audience hears or reads, so it needs to be captivating. Think of it as the trailer for your main story. The intro should immediately grab attention and give a sneak peek of what's to come. Next up is the body of the script. This is where you deliver the meat of your story. Break it down into logical sections, using clear and concise language. Support your claims with facts, quotes, and visual elements. The body of the script should provide all the necessary information, explained clearly, accurately, and contextually. Finally, the conclusion is your wrap-up. It's the last impression you'll leave with your audience. Summarize the main points, offer a final thought, or leave them with something to ponder. 1. The Power of Research
Before you start writing, you need to gather information. This is where you put on your investigative hat and dig into the topic. Find reliable sources, verify your facts, and get multiple perspectives. Your research forms the backbone of your script, ensuring accuracy and credibility. The best news scripts are based on solid, well-researched information. Your audience trusts you to provide accurate and unbiased reports, so proper research is essential. Gather information from multiple sources, and always verify your facts before including them in your script.
2. Outlining Your Story
Once you have your information, it's time to organize it. Create an outline that maps out the structure of your script. This helps you clarify your thoughts and create a logical flow. Your outline should include the intro, body paragraphs, and conclusion. Consider the order in which you present your information. What's the most compelling way to tell this story? The outline stage is your planning phase. Map out your script's structure, deciding on the order in which you will present your information. This phase includes the intro, body paragraphs, and conclusion. Think about the most engaging way to present your information to keep your audience interested.
3. Crafting the Intro and Conclusion
As we mentioned earlier, the intro and conclusion are crucial. The intro should grab attention immediately, while the conclusion should leave a lasting impression. Think of these as the bookends of your story. A strong intro and conclusion are key to making a memorable news script. The intro must hook the audience right away, while the conclusion should provide a strong closing statement. Use compelling language, a thought-provoking question, or a surprising statistic to get your audience interested from the get-go.
4. Writing the Body
This is where you flesh out the details. Write clear, concise paragraphs that support your main points. Use active voice, avoid jargon, and support your claims with evidence. Break up your text with visuals, quotes, and other multimedia elements. This makes your script easier to read and more engaging. Use active voice to make your writing more direct and engaging, and always support your claims with evidence from your research. Add visuals to your script to break up the text and keep your audience engaged. Quotes, images, and video clips can all enhance your script and make it more appealing to your audience.
5. Editing and Proofreading
Once you've written your script, it's time to edit and proofread. Check for errors in grammar, spelling, and punctuation. Make sure your language is clear and concise, and that your script flows logically. Read your script aloud to catch any awkward phrasing or unclear sentences. Editing and proofreading is a non-negotiable step. Review your script for grammatical errors, awkward phrasing, and clarity. Reading your script aloud helps you identify areas that need improvement and ensures a smoother reading experience for your audience.
